Catalog number: 544 - MBS6034259-1mg
Product Category: Business & Industrial > Science & Laboratory
Size: 1(mg
MBS6034259-1mg
MBS6034259-5x1mg
M264697
1189427-82-4
MBS6076716-5x25mg
MBS6020892-1mg
MBS6020892-5x1mg